Amman, March 10 (QNA) – Jordan on Tuesday condemned in the strongest terms a drone attack targeting the Consulate General of the United Arab Emirates in Iraq’s Kurdistan Region, calling for full respect for international law protecting diplomatic missions.
Jordan’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s stressed the need to respect international law, including the 1949 Geneva Conventions and the 1961 Vienna Convention on Diplomatic Relations, which guarantee the protection of diplomatic premises and personnel.
The UAE Consulate General in the Kurdistan Region of Iraq was targeted by a drone attack, causing material damage but no casualties. (QNA)
